操作系统中的权限管理详解:如何设置用户权限?

时间:2025-04-21 12:52:42 分类:操作系统

众所周知,权限管理在操作系统中占据着至关重要的地位,关系到系统的安全性与稳定性。在当今互联网环境中,对用户权限的有效管理显得尤为必要。无论是企业内部网络还是个人计算机,合理设置用户权限可以有效防止信息泄露与数据损坏。掌握操作系统中的权限管理,是每位系统管理员和IT从业人员的基本技能。

操作系统中的权限管理详解:如何设置用户权限?

具体而言,用户权限管理涉及到多个层次,包括文件系统的访问权限、进程的执行权限以及网络访问控制等。在Linux系统中,通常采用三种基本权限:读(r)、写(w)、执行(x)。通过对文件和目录的权限设置,管理员可以限制用户的操作范围,确保只有合适的人员可以进行敏感操作。

Windows操作系统的权限管理则有所不同,采用的是基于用户账户控制(UAC)和访问控制列表(ACL)的机制。Windows允许管理员设置复杂的权限规则,用户可以被分配至不同的用户组,继而获得相应的权限。掌握这些知识,对于提高系统安全性有着很大帮助。

在实际操作中,有几点注意事项尤为重要。合理的权限设置不仅能增强系统安全性,还能提高工作效率。以下是一些实用的设置建议:

1. 最小权限原则:每个用户或程序只应被授予完成其任务所需的最低权限。过大的权限范围会导致安全隐患。

2. 定期审计权限:权限设置不是一劳永逸的,随着用户角色和工作内容的变化,定期审计用户权限非常必要。

3. 使用组管理:通过将用户分组来管理权限,可以简化管理流程,维护时也更加高效。

除了基础权限设置,还可以通过一些性能优化技巧来提升操作系统的运行效率。例如,在Linux上,使用`chmod`命令可以轻松修改文件权限,而在Windows中,可以通过文件属性对话框方便地设置ACL。合适的文件系统配置和合理的网络访问策略也是不可忽视的部分。

个人用户在设置权限时,往往忽略了某些小细节。例如,在共享文件时,应该考虑选择只读或限制修改权限,以避免不必要的数据丢失。在涉及多用户环境的情况下,使用如VPN等安全方式进行远程访问,也能进一步保障安全性。

用户权限管理是确保操作系统正常运行的重要组成部分。通过科学的管理、定期的审计以及合理的配置,将有助于构建一个更加安全高效的计算环境。

常见问题解答

1. 如何在Linux中查看文件权限?

使用`ls -l`命令可以查看文件的权限信息,包括文件的所有者和所属组。

2. Windows操作系统中,如何设置文件的访问权限?

右键点击文件或文件夹,选择属性,在安全选项卡中进行详细的权限设置。

3. 什么是最小权限原则?

最小权限原则要求用户或程序只被授予执行任务所需的最低权限,从而减少潜在的安全风险。

4. 如何定期审计用户权限?

可以使用系统自带的审核工具,定期记录用户权限的变更,并根据实际需要调整权限设置。

5. 使用用户组管理权限有什么好处?

通过用户组管理,可以在大规模用户管理中节省时间,提高权限管理的效率,便于更新和维护。